8/21 NEW SAILOR OPEN HOUSE CANCELLED
DEAR PROSPECTIVE AND RETURNING SAILORS,
Unfortunately, the scheduled new sailor open house for this Sunday has been cancelled due to traffic and parking concerns at Belmont related to the Air and Water Show and a large regatta. We encourage anyone who is not familiar with our sailing venue at Chicago Yacht Club, Belmont Harbor to visit on their own simply to see where we sail. All interested sailors are invited to attend the Kick-Off meeting on Monday, August 29th, 7-8:30 @ the Wilmette Public Library on the corner of Wilmette and Park Ave. Feel free to arrive as early at 6:45. A new sailor Q & A will be held at the end of the meeting (8-8:30 pm) to answer questions and discuss required gear etc… Below is a quick overview of the season:
- Fall Kick-Off Meeting on Monday, August 29th 7-8:30 pm @ the Wilmette Public Library (lower level) for both returning and new sailors. This meeting is mandatory for all sailors and a parent to attend. Required forms will be completed and collected. For new sailors, team and yacht club fees will not be collected until after tryouts are complete.
- Sailing begins September 6th after school 3:30-7:30/7:45 (includes bus travel time)
- Tryouts for Varsity, JV and Development team to be held the first week of the season.
- Practice Schedule is: JV and Varsity T-Th (3:30-7:45), Sat (10-4), Varsity only Wed (3:30-730), Development Sat only (10-4). Bus will be provided Tues and Thurs only.

Prior to the Kick-Off, we ask that you review our “about” section on www.newtriersailing.com, and consider your interest in trying out for Varsity or Junior Varsity, or starting with the Development squad. The sailing team is a large time commitment and it is important to seriously consider your other extracurricular and academic commitments. As always, we have a large number of interested sailors and the first week of the season will be dedicated to tryouts and team assignments. The team can typically accommodate about 25 sailors on the JV and Varsity combined. However, this number varies depending on level of experience and skipper-crew combinations. For less experienced or less committed sailors, the Development team on Saturdays can be a great starting point!
